    Morning Lineup - 4/1/20 - In Like a Bear...
    Wed, Apr 1, 2020

    Happy April Fool's Day. If only the picture of the futures market right now were a prank, but those numbers are real (at least for now). After a month-end rally tied to rebalancing, US futures are kicking off the new quarter on a down note as comments from the President last night that his administration now expects 100K - 240K deaths from the COVID-19 outbreak under a best-case scenario has really spooked investors. While those estimates are no doubt concerning, we would reiterate the point we have been making for some time now that the headlines are going to get a lot worse in the days and weeks ahead, so this shouldn't be a major surprise.

    The S&P 500 is poised to open down over 3.5% this morning and if those numbers hold through the close it would be the 2nd worst start to a quarter in the history of the S&P 500. The only one that was worse was the first trading day of 1932 when the S&P 500 kicked off the quarter with a decline of 6.9%. The only other quarter besides that where the S&P 500 declined more than 3% was in October 1998 during the Russian debt crisis and the collapse of the hedge fund Long-Term Capital Management.

    Hopefully, this quarter's weak start isn't a sign that we're in for more of the same in Q2 as we saw in Q1 and March. For starters, the S&P 500's average daily change during the month of March was 4.8% which ranks as the most volatile month in the history of the S&P 500 (first chart)! Second, with a decline of 20% during the quarter, the S&P 500 had its worst quarter since Q4 2008 and just the 9th 20%+ decline on record (second chart).

    Morning Lineup - 4/2/20 - 2% of the Population Files For Unemployment
    Thu, Apr 2, 2020

    All eyes were on jobless claims this morning, which were expected to rise by 3.7mm, though estimates were wide-ranging from 800,000 to 6.5mm. So, where did they come in? How about 6.648 million. That was above all economists forecasts!

    Equity markets were pricing a gain of more than 1% but have given up half of those gains in the immediate aftermath of the report.

    Last week's jobless claims reading reflected the fact that 1% of the US population filed for unemployment. With claims doubling this week, that means 2% of the US population filed for claims this week Not the labor force but the entire population. Given the moves in claims over the last two weeks, the historical chart of claims is essentially useless. That surge in claims we saw during the financial crisis? It looks like nothing more than a speed bump in relation to what we're going through now.
